本課程設計題目的主要內容是模擬十字路口交通燈(紅、黃、綠三色)的顯示控制。設計要求:1.主干道計時60秒,次干道計時45秒,時間到則切換紅綠燈;2.紅綠燈不變期間,在七段數碼管上顯示每秒倒計時;3.計時到最后5秒時,兩個方向的黃燈同時閃爍直至計時到0。
上傳時間: 2022-05-11
上傳用戶:
通電后,進水指示燈亮起,用戶通過對按鍵的操作選擇洗衣服的哪一個流程,若直接選擇啟動按鍵,則洗衣機從進水→洗衣服→泡洗→脫水→出水→結束進行整個流程。若不直接選擇啟動,那么用戶可以根據自己的需要對菜單選擇鍵進行操作,把洗衣機切換到自己想要的那個流程去。⑴洗滌過程:在進入洗滌過程,首先進水閥接通,開始向洗衣機供水,當到達要求水位時,進水閥斷電關閉,停止進水;電機M接通,帶動波輪旋轉,形成洗衣水流。電機M是一個正反轉電機,可以形成往返水流,有利于洗滌衣物。⑵漂洗過程:與洗滌過程操作相同,只是時間短一些。⑶脫水過程:洗滌或漂洗過程結束后,電機M停止轉動,排水閥M接通,開始排水。排水閥動作的同時,電機M也接通,使電機可以帶動內桶轉動。當水位低到一定值,再經過一段時間后,電機開始正轉,帶動內桶高速旋轉,甩干衣物。 unsigned char as; //水位,保存sbit k1=P1^0;//進水閥控制端口sbit k2=P1^1;//排水閥控制端口sbit k3=P1^2;//電機控制繼電器一號sbit k4=P1^3;//電機控制繼電器2號sbit led1=P2^0;//浸泡洗指示燈sbit led2=P2^1;//速洗指示燈sbit led3=P2^2;//標準洗指示燈sbit led4=P2^3;//脫水指示燈sbit led5=P2^4;//烘干指示燈sbit s1=P3^2;//數碼管顯示第一位公共端sbit s2=P3^3;//數碼管第二位顯示控制公共端sbit k5=P3^0;//烘干電機sbit ks1=P3^4;//洗衣機電源開關sbit ks2=P3^5;//洗衣機模式選擇sbit ks3=P3^6;//啟動按鍵sbit kk1=P3^1;//洗滌完報警參考仿真圖:
上傳時間: 2022-05-14
上傳用戶:
基于STC89C51單片機的智能電熱水器的控制器的設計,要達到的控制要求有:(1)用LCD1602液晶顯示水溫、設置上下限和定時時間,(2)水溫檢測顯示范圍為00~99℃,精度為±1℃。(3)溫度預設范圍為0~99℃,當檢測溫度低于預設溫度時,開始加熱;檢測溫度高于預設溫度時,停止加熱。(4)設置4個程序按鍵。分別問設置按鍵、加鍵、減鍵、確定。(5)可以紅外遙控,通過紅外一體接收探頭接收遙控器信號,執行與主板按鍵同等功能。(6)有水位檢測功能,無水自動上水,無水不加熱。//外部中斷解碼程序_外部中斷0void intersvr1(void) interrupt 2 using 1{ TR0=1; Tc=TH0*256+TL0;//提取中斷時間間隔時長 TH0=0; TL0=0; //定時中斷重新置零 if((Tc>Imin)&&(Tc<Imax)) { m=0; f=1; return; } //找到啟始碼 if(f==1) { if(Tc>Inum1&&Tc<Inum3) { Im[m/8]=Im[m/8]>>1|0x80; m++; } if(Tc>Inum2&&Tc<Inum1) { Im[m/8]=Im[m/8]>>1; m++; //取碼 } if(m==32) { m=0; f=0; if(Im[2]==~Im[3]) { IrOK=1; TR0=0; } else IrOK=0; //取碼完成后判斷讀碼是否正確 } //準備讀下一碼 }}
上傳時間: 2022-05-14
上傳用戶:
控制理論基礎(中文版)控制系統的工作原理: 控制系統的工作原理:檢測輸出量(被控制量)的實際值; 檢測輸出量(被控制量)的實際值;將輸出量的實際值與給定值(輸入量)進行比較 將輸出量的實際值與給定值(輸入量)進行比較 得出偏差; 得出偏差;用偏差值產生控制調節作用去消除偏差,使得輸 用偏差值產生控制調節作用去消除偏差,使得輸 出量維持期望的輸出
標簽: 控制理論
上傳時間: 2022-05-22
上傳用戶:bluedrops
溫度、濕度檢測在工農業生產、醫學研究等科研工作中具有非常重要的地位。溫度、濕度是科研工作中相當重要的參數,如何準確地測量、并且進行數據分析、統計,對科研工作的開展和科研結果的發布有著極其重要的影響。本論文就實際工作需要,解決工作中的實際問題,希望能夠利用虛擬儀器構建一套遠程溫、濕度控制系統。文中首先簡要介紹虛擬儀器的概念、特點,概述了虛擬儀器的現狀及其未來的發展,并將它與傳統的儀器進行了比較,突出了虛擬儀器的優點,同時也涉及了目前應用最廣泛,最具有優勢的虛擬儀器編程軟件LabVIEW的特點及編程方法。 為了能夠構建一套穩定可靠的溫、濕度控制系統,確保實驗數據的準確性和統計的方便與合理,本文重點介紹利用LabVIEW語言開發出一套溫、濕度控制系統,該系統以鉑電阻作為溫度傳感器;電容式傳感器作為濕度敏感元件,采用美國的NI公司的數據采集卡USB-6008采集溫度、濕度信號,通過Internet網絡可以實時的監測和控制溫、濕度的變化,通過對采集到的數據進行分析和處理,實現數據的報表打印、數據的遠程共享,溫、濕度的上、下限報警等等。 利用溫、濕度傳感器和數據采集卡檢測溫室內溫度和濕度參數變化,實現了實驗數據的自動采集。針對溫室控制過程中溫度和濕度存在耦合問題,運用了模糊解耦控制。在模糊解耦控制過程中,根據長期的實踐經驗總結,制定出了較為合理的溫濕度隸屬度函數表和模糊解耦控制規則輸出表。在去模糊化的過程中,為了便于軟件實現,根據Mamdani型模糊推理算法用MATLAB語言編寫出了模糊決策表的輸出程序。采用目前國際上流行的虛擬儀器技術,進行了計算機測控系統的設計,與傳統測試中采用的多參數分別用單個儀器檢測、數據單獨匯總處理的方式,或基于單片機的數據采集處理系統相比,虛擬儀器技術的應用大大提高了檢測和控制的精度,提高了數據處理的速度,并增強了系統的通用性、可靠性、可維護性和可擴展性。采用LabVIEW虛擬儀器開發平臺和模塊化設計方法,實現了環境參數的實時獲取、采集信息的實時顯示、控制信號的準確輸出及數據的自動處理,減少了人為干預,增加了測控過程的穩定性,避免人為的讀數誤差和計算誤差。在系統試驗研究階段,對系統溫濕度參數的自動采集進行試驗設計和試驗結果分析,從數...
上傳時間: 2022-05-25
上傳用戶:
作為一種全新的探測技術,激光雷達已廣泛應用于大氣、陸地、海洋探測、空中交會對接、偵察成像、化學試劑探測等領域。與傳統雷達技術相比,激光雷達是一種通過發射特定波長的激光,處理并分析回波信號,實現目標探測的技術,具有高測量精度、精細的時間和空間分辨率,以及極大的探測距離等優點,目前已成為一種重要的探測手段。激光雷達探測系統需采用硬件電路實現系統的控制以及回波信號的處理、分析,從而實現目標距離、速度、姿態等參數的測量,因此研制高速、高精度、性能穩定、性價比高、保密性強的處理電路,對提升激光雷達探測系統的整體性能有著十分重要的意義。 激光雷達系統控制及信號處理電路有多種實現方案,傳統的MCU實現方案較為普遍,但受線程的帶寬限制,且難以提高系統的精度與復雜性;采用 FPGA、ARM或DSP實現信號處理架構,一定程度上提高了系統的帶寬與復雜度,但成本較高,功耗較大,且開發周期較長。針對目前激光目標探測系統中,對系統控制復雜度,信號處理實時性,整體性能與功耗等要求,論文提出了一種基于 CPLD與MCU架構的電路改進方案。該方案采用高速并行的現場可編程PLD器件,完成相關電路的控制與回波信號的實時處理、分析;同時選用線程處理優勢較強的MCU,實現相關信號的控制與高速串口的收發,完成PC軟件終端的通信。 本文結合所提出的基于 CPLD與 MCU架構的硬件電路設計方案,選用了Altera的MAX II CPLD器件EPM240T100C5N,以及宏晶科技公司的增強型單片機STC12LE5A60S2,實現了激光雷達系統控制及信號處理等功能。文中詳細介紹了實驗系統的設備資源與硬件電路的模塊化設計,完成了相關外設的驅動控制,并采用 CPLD與 MCU完成了回波信號的采集、處理與分析,最終通過與所設計PC軟件終端的通信,實現與硬件電路板的實時數據上傳。 目前板卡在100MHz主頻下工作,可完成10kHz激光器的觸發,并行實現回波信號的實時處理與分析,以及921600波特率下的高速串口通信。結合激光雷達實驗系統,多次進行硬件電路的測試與實驗,表明本文設計的激光雷達系統控制及信號處理硬件電路功能正常,性能穩定,且功耗低,保密性強,符合設計的需求,實驗證明本文所提出方案的具有一定的可...
上傳時間: 2022-05-28
上傳用戶:xsr1983
蔬菜大棚溫度濕度自動控制系統由主控制器AT89C51單片機、并行口擴展芯片255,74LS373,AD轉換器0809、濕度傳感器、溫度傳感器DS1820、固態繼電器、RAM6264、掉電保護和LED顯示器和報警電路等構成,實現對蔬菜大棚溫濕度的檢測與控制,從而有效提高蔬菜的產量。文中提出了具體設計方案,討論了蔬菜大棚溫濕度巡回檢測與控制的基本原理,進行了可行性論證。給出了電路圖和程序流程圖并附有源星序。由于利用了單片機及數字控制系統的優點,系統的各方面性能得到了顯著的提高。關鍵詞:溫濕度傳感器;濕度傳感器;快速檢測;A/D轉換器:LED顯示器;報警電路;固態繼電器;溫室環境測控,即根據植物生長發育的需要,自動調節溫室內環境條件的總稱。現代化溫室,通過傳感器技術、微型計算機及單片機技術和人工智能技術,能自動測控溫室的環境,其中包括溫度、濕度、光照、co2濃度等,使作物在不適宜生長發育的反季節中,獲得比室外生長更優的環境條件,達到早熟、優質、高產的目的。在農業種植問題中,溫室環境與生物的生長、發育、能量交換密切相關,進行環境測控是實現溫室生產管理自動化、科學化的基本保證,通過對監測數據的分析,結合作物生長發育規律,控制環境條件,達到作物優質、高產、高效盼栽培目的。傳統的環境測控管理采用模擬控制儀表和人工管理方法,工作效率低。隨著微機技術的發展,逐步采用配置靈活、開放式結構、運算能力較強、高可靠性、完善的開發手段及具有數據處理、統計分析、打印報表等功能的測控系統所代替,取得了較好的經濟效益。隨著國民經濟的迅速增長,現代農業得到長足發展,受控農業的研究和應用技術越來越受到重視,特別是溫室工程已成為工廠化高效農業的一個重要組成部分。支持溫室工程的相關技術,如溫室環境復雜系統的建模技術與專家決策支持系統、溫室環境智能測控技術研究與系統開發、溫室環境調配工程技術與設施研究等已成為當前該領域的關鍵技術和研究熱點問題。研究溫室環境信息進行模擬、分析、預測,研究開發基于作物成長栽培環境的溫室環境多因子智能化綜合測控系統,研究高效生產的溫室環境綜合測控模式與配套設施等將是今后主要研究內容。
上傳時間: 2022-05-30
上傳用戶:jiabin
0.1設計的目的和意義鍋爐燒水產生高溫高壓的蒸汽,蒸汽溫度可以達到1000多度,用這樣的蒸汽可以用來消毒,煮飯,燒開水等?,F在學校,工廠的食堂燒水做飯就是用鍋爐燒水產生的蒸汽做的。鍋爐汽包水位控制是維持鍋筒水位在允許的范圍內,使鍋爐的給水量適應鍋爐的蒸發量。由于鍋爐的水位同時受到鍋好側和氣輪機側的影響,因此,當鍋爐負荷變化或氣輪機用汽量變化時,通過給水調節系統保持鍋爐的水位正常是保證鍋爐和氣輪機安全運行的重要條件。水位過高或過低,都是不允許的。水位過高會影響汽水分離器的正常工作,嚴重時會導致蒸汽帶水增加,使過熱器管壁和氣輪機葉片結垢,造成事故;鍋爐出口蒸汽帶水過多還會使過熱蒸汽溫度產生急劇變化。水位過低,則會破壞正常水循環,危及水冷壁受熱面的安全。一般要求鍋筒水位維持。在水位控制系統中,主要采用“三沖量控制”方案來實現鍋爐汽包水位控制更是重ф之?.本設計是通過了解了鍋爐汽包水位控制的發展并在具體分析 動、靜特性的基礎上從單沖量控制到雙沖量控制最后到三沖量控制的設計方案中擇優選擇了“三沖量”控制,具體的方案設計存在的優缺點詳見下文解析。0.2應解決的主要問題2ns本設計主要解決傳感器的選擇(溫度,壓力,水位),輸出道的設計和軟件程序的設計。其所能達到的技術指標為:(1)可以對鍋爐水位,蒸汽量和給水量分別買集(2)通過單片機控制,使鍋爐汽包水位維持在正常的范圍內(3)只有鍵盤顯示功能(4)具有報警功能當水位超過上限或下限時,能及時報警,
標簽: 水位控制系統
上傳時間: 2022-05-30
上傳用戶:
摘要:隨著人們生活水平的提高,各種熱水器的使用已相當普及。與之相配套的控制儀也相繼問世。然而目前市場上的各種熱水器控制電路還與理想要求相差甚遠。消費者需要真正的“自動”控制,以實現使用的最簡單化。就像家用電視機、電冰箱一樣,按通電源、設定完畢這么簡單就可以了。本次畢業設計運用AT89C51單片機設計了一種自動控制電路,該電路用于太陽能熱水器,能實現在用水時,若水位不夠可以自動供水,若日曬水溫達不到設定值,則電加熱自動補溫。從而實現了熱水器的自動及節能。太陽能熱水器自動控制硬件電路,輔以相應的軟件設計,來實現溫度和水位參數的實時顯示,而且具有溫度設定、水位設定與控制功能,停電后再來電時也不用重新設定,具有故障報警和故障自處理功能,良好的穩定性和抗干擾性能。實驗結果表明,本次系統設計合理,工作穩定可靠、溫度測量精度高。同時給出了溫度測量系統的硬件結構和軟件設計當前能源緊缺,用電緊張,太陽能是綠色能源,得到廣大用戶的喜愛。使用太陽能熱水器時存在的問題:不可缺水,空曬情況下上水會爆炸;春、秋天,水溫升高蒸發,造成熱能損失;冬天水溫不夠,須用電等等。采用太陽能熱水器智能儀(儀稱太陽能熱水器水溫水位測控儀),能解決上述問題。使用戶省心,使用方便,智能運行,用戶不必作任何操作。太陽能是一種低密度、間歇性、空間分布不斷變化的能源,與常規能源有很大的區別,這就對太陽能的收集和利用提出了較高的要求。在太陽能熱利用中,為了得到中高溫熱能,必須使集熱器從日出到日落跟蹤太陽,而在太陽能光電中,相同條件下,自動跟蹤發電設備要比固定發電設備的發電量提高35%,成本下降25%,因此在太陽能利用中,進行跟蹤裝置的控制方式進行研究是一項很有意義的工作。
上傳時間: 2022-05-30
上傳用戶:得之我幸78
本次設計為一個基于單片機的飲水機的溫度控制系統,該系統可以實時檢測飲水機水箱的水溫,并且可以通過數碼管顯示飲水機水箱水溫度數,可以通過鍵盤或開關選擇制冷或加熱,可以人為設置水的溫度的上下限,如加熱,當溫度在設定的范圍內時正常工作,當低于水溫下限時控制加熱器加熱;如制冷,當溫度高于水溫上限時控制壓縮機制冷,溫度檢測范圍0~95℃,精度±1℃,當溫度超過設定值時具有示警功能。
上傳時間: 2022-06-08
上傳用戶:XuVshu